How Our Team Handles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air
A proper process is crucial with hardwood floor water damage repair. Our team follows a meticulous approach to ensure your floors are restored to their pre-damage condition. We’ll assess the damage, extract standing water, dry the affected area, and then repair or replace the damaged wood.
Step 1: Assess and Document the Damage
Our team arrives quickly to assess the damage and take photos and notes. This documentation is crucial for the insurance claims process.
Step 2: Extract Standing Water
We use powerful pumps to extract standing water from your hardwood floors. This step is critical in preventing further damage and promoting drying.
Step 3: Dry the Affected Area
Our technicians use industrial-grade drying equipment to dry your hardwood floors efficiently. This step may take 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 4: Repair or Replace Damaged Wood
Our craftsmen will repair or replace the damaged wood, ensuring a seamless finish that blends with the rest of your hardwood floors.

Warning Signs You Need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air
Beyond the obvious signs of water damage, there are earlier warning signs that show you need to act fast.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Growth of mold and mildew can show that water has been present for an extended period.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to costly repairs.
Warped or Buckled Hardwood
Visible signs of warping or buckling on your hardwood floors show that water has damaged the wood. Don’t delay, as this can spread and cause further damage.

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air Cost In Lake Stevens, WA
The cost of hardwood floor water damage repair can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lake Stevens, WA. These estimates are based on real-world costs and may not reflect your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water extracted and the equipment used affect the cost. |
| Wood Repair or Repl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the type of wood used affect the cost.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the equipment used affect the cost. |
| Insurance Claims Help | $0 – $1,000 | The complexity of the claim and the level of help needed affect the cost. |
| Post-Restoration Inspection and Certification | $200 – $1,000 | The extent of the damage and the level of documentation required affect the cost. |

Common Questions About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air
What’s the typical timeline for hardwood floor water damage repair?
Our team works efficiently to complete the repair process within 3-5 days. But, the actual timeline may vary depending on the severity of the damage and the complexity of the project.
How do I prevent water damage to my hardwood floors?
Regular inspections and maintenance can help prevent water damage. Ensure your plumbing systems are functioning correctly, and keep an eye out for signs of water damage, such as warping or musty odors.
